Hadith.747 - In the narration of Zurarah from Imam Muhammad ibn Ali Al-Baqir (as), said: "If there is a distance between her and him that is about the length of a step or about the length of a cubit or more, then there is no harm if She prays beside him alone."
747 - وَ فِي رِوَايَةِ زُرَارَةَ عَنْ أَبِي جَعْفَرٍ عَلَيْهِ اَلسَّلاَمُ: «إِذَا كَانَ بَيْنَهَا وَ بَيْنَهُ قَدْرُ مَا يُتَخَطَّى أَوْ قَدْرُ عَظْمِ ذِرَاعٍ فَصَاعِداً فَلاَ بَأْسَ إِنْ صَلَّتْ بِحِذَاهُ وَحْدَهَا.
